Abstract
This paper presents a novel approach for determining the critical lateral-torsional buckling loads of beams subjected to arbitrarily transverse loads. This new method is developed based on the classical energy method. However, the difference of the present method from the traditional energy methods is the formulation of potential energy of external loads, which is expressed in terms of the internal bending moment and internal shear force in the pre-buckling stage regardless of the type of loading. Compared to the traditional formulations of the potential energy of external loads, not only is the present formula simple in the form, easy and convenient in the calculation, but it also provides a unified form for calculating accurate critical load of lateral-torsional buckling of the beams.
